The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of George Rushworth, born in 1841 in Wakefield, Yorkshire, consisted of 3 members. George was the head of the household, married to Louisa Rushworth, born in 1850 in Bradford, Yorksh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was George's Wifes Sister, Sophia Firth, born in 1853 in Bradford, Yorkshire, England.
